Description

Intelligent watch with body temperature detection function
Technical Field
The utility model relates to an intelligence wrist-watch field particularly, relates to an intelligence wrist-watch with body temperature detects function.
Background
The intelligent watch has information processing capacity and meets the basic technical requirements of watches. Besides indicating time, the smart watch also has one or more functions of reminding, navigation, calibration, monitoring, interaction and the like, the display modes comprise pointers, numbers, images and the like, the functions of the smart watch are improved along with the development of science and technology, and part of the smart watch has the function of detecting the body temperature of a wearer.
The intelligent watch depends on the body temperature detection module arranged on the intelligent watch to complete body temperature detection of a wearer, but the body temperature detection module is fixed on the watch body more, so that the intelligent watch is not only unfavorable for maintenance, but also can be completed by wearing the watch when body temperature detection is carried out, and the part and the application range which are detected by the intelligent watch have great limitations. Therefore, the intelligent watch with the body temperature detection function is provided.

As shown in fig. 1, 2, 3, 4, 5, and 6, the present embodiment provides a smart watch having a body temperature detection function, including a watch body 1 and a band mechanism 2 provided on the watch body 1, wherein a body temperature detection mechanism 3 for detecting a body temperature is provided on a back surface of the watch body 1, and a pair of fixing mechanisms 4 for fixing the body temperature detection mechanism 3 to the watch body 1 are provided on the body temperature detection mechanism 3.
As shown in fig. 1, 2, and 3, in addition to the above embodiment, the band mechanism 2 further includes a first band 201 and a second band 203 provided on the watch body 1, the first band 201 is provided with a clasp 202, and the second band 203 is provided with a plurality of clasp holes 204 used in cooperation with the clasp 202.
As shown in fig. 1, 2, 3, 4 and 5, in addition to the above-mentioned embodiments, as a preferred embodiment, the body temperature detecting mechanism 3 further includes two insertion holes 301 symmetrically formed in the watch body 1 and a supporting block 302 provided on the watch body 1, a body temperature detecting module 303 for detecting the body temperature is provided on the supporting block 302, and the body temperature detecting module 303 can be supported by the supporting block 302.
As shown in fig. 1, fig. 2, fig. 3, fig. 4 and fig. 5, as a preferred embodiment, on the basis of the above manner, further, the fixing mechanism 4 includes a first groove 401 and a second groove 405 which are provided on the supporting block 302, a guide block 402, a limiting block 403 and a connecting block 404 are sequentially provided in the first groove 401 from bottom to top, the connecting block 404 is fixedly connected with the top end of the limiting block 403, and both the connecting block 404 and the limiting block 403 are slidably connected with the inner wall of the first groove 401.
As shown in fig. 1, 2, 3, 4, 5 and 6, as a preferred embodiment, on the basis of the above-mentioned manner, further, a second spring 409 is disposed between the limiting block 403 and the guide block 402, an L-shaped hanging rod 410 is hinged on the limiting block 403, a positioning block 411 disposed below the L-shaped hanging rod 410 is fixedly mounted in the first groove 401, the positioning block 411 is attached to only one inner wall of the first groove 401, so as to prevent the positioning block 411 from affecting the movement of the bottom end of the L-shaped hanging rod 410, a locking groove 412 and a guide plate 413 are disposed at the bottom end of the positioning block 411, a guide slope 414 is disposed at the top end of the positioning block 411, during the descending process of the limiting block 403 and the L-shaped hanging rod 410, the bottom end of the L-shaped hanging rod 410 is inclined toward the second spring 409 under the guide of the guide slope 414, when the bottom end of the L-shaped hanging rod 410 is separated from the guide slope 414, the L-shaped hanging rod 410 is reset and vertical, when the connecting block 404 is released, the L-shaped hanging rod 410 is lifted and hung on the locking groove 412, therefore, the position of the limiting block 403 after descending is fixed, the situation that the limiting block 403 ascends to push the limiting rod 407 to reset when the connecting block 404 is loosened, so that the body temperature detection mechanism 3 cannot be taken down from the watch body 1 can be avoided, the L-shaped hanging rod 410 descends by pressing the connecting block 404 again when the body temperature detection mechanism 3 is placed back on the watch body 1, the bottom end of the L-shaped hanging rod 410 inclines towards the direction away from the second spring 409 under the guidance of the top slope of the guide block 402, when the connecting block 404 is loosened, the bottom end of the L-shaped hanging rod 410 ascends from the side, away from the second spring 409, of the positioning block 411 and finally separates from the positioning block 411 under the guidance of the guide plate 413 facing away from the second spring 409, so that the limitation on the limiting block 403 is removed, at the moment, the limiting rod 407 can be reset and inserted into the jack 301 to fix the body temperature detection mechanism 3, and the operation of a user is facilitated.
As shown in fig. 1, 2, 3, 4, 5, and 6, as a preferred embodiment, on the basis of the above manner, further, a supporting plate 406 moving along the second groove 405 is disposed in the second groove 405, a limiting rod 407 is disposed on the supporting plate 406, one end of the limiting rod 407 penetrates through the supporting block 302 and is inserted into the insertion hole 301 in a matching manner, the other end of the limiting rod 407 extends into the first groove 401 and contacts with the limiting block 403, slopes are disposed on both a surface of the limiting block 403 contacting with the limiting rod 407 and a top surface of the guide block 402, the slope on the guide block 402 can guide the L-shaped hanging rod 410, and the slopes on the limiting block 403 and the limiting rod 407 can enable the limiting block 403 to extrude the limiting rod 407 so that the limiting rod 407 extends out.
As shown in fig. 1, 2, 3 and 4, as a preferred embodiment, on the basis of the above manner, a first spring 408 is further disposed on the limiting rod 407 and located between the supporting plate 406 and the second notch 405, an end of the first spring 408 is fixedly connected to the supporting plate 406 and the second notch 405, respectively, and an elastic force of the first spring 408 is smaller than an elastic force of the second spring 409, so that the second spring 409 can push the limiting block 403 to press the limiting rod 407.
Specifically, this intelligent wrist-watch with body temperature detects function when during operation/use: at first put the table body 1 in the user's wrist, and make body temperature detection mechanism 3 and user's wrist laminating, then wear table body 1 on the user's wrist through watchband mechanism 2, can carry out the body temperature to the person of wearing through body temperature detection mechanism 3 and detect, when the need takes off body temperature detection mechanism 3 exclusive use, at first place this intelligence wrist-watch level and make body temperature detection mechanism 3 up, press connecting block 404 and make stopper 403 descend, and the effort of first spring 408 can drive gag lever post 407 removal and separate with jack 301, then take off body temperature detection mechanism 3 and use, after the use is accomplished, put back table body 1 with body temperature detection mechanism 3 in, it can to press connecting block 404 once more.
